Confidentiality
As a consultant, you have to value and prioritize discretion. Clients trust you to keep their details personal, as well as you should certainly not divulge any details without their permission. This is actually especially important in counseling clients of any kind of grow older; adults suppose their privacy is actually secured yet children and also teens typically experience fearful that their info might be discussed.
It’s essential that your customer documents particulars your privacy plan and the situations under which you may need to have to damage discretion, such as a subpoena or even legal requirement. When you need to have to notify a client that you’re breaking privacy, talk about the condition with all of them in an open as well as empathetic manner as well as inquire just how they wish to go ahead.
Preserving privacy is a vital part of structure trust fund along with customers as well as ensuring the principles of beneficence (avoidance of danger), nonmaleficence, justice and also equivalent therapy. This additionally lessens the odds of solvable concerns becoming catastrophic in future.
Inclusion
Introduction is a vital component of guidance. It includes understanding and also appreciating the unique backgrounds, experiences, and also identifications of clients. It also includes recognizing that unfairness and bias can affect psychological health and wellness and health.
Additionally, consultants must definitely seek out possibilities to take part in cultural proficiency instruction as well as workshops. Incorporating these social factors in to restorative practice are going to ensure inclusivity and encourage a more collaborative relationship.
As an example, consultants need to prevent utilizing foreign language that denotes a shortage of approval for differences in race, sex, sexual alignment, socioeconomic condition, faith, and also other dimensions of identity. Furthermore, they should find responses from marginalized folx to make sure that their inclusion attempts are actually efficient.
Folx with impairments can especially take advantage of addition projects that take care of the wide spread concerns of ableism and the barricades to accessing treatment. This means addressing obstacles in physical areas, such as psychological health “deserts” where no companies are offered, and additionally creating therapy much more available using telehealth.
